Juan Carlos García

Honduran footballer (1988-2018)

Juan Carlos García (8 March 1988 – 8 January 2018) was a Honduran footballer.

He began his career at Marathón and later went on to C.D. Olimpia. Before transferring to Wigan in 2013 he was loaned to CD Tenerife.

A full international since 2009, García has earned over 30 caps for Honduras. He was included in their squads for three CONCACAF Gold Cups and the 2014 FIFA World Cup.

García died from leukemia on 8 January 2018 at the age of 29.[3]
